Implementing Koha for EIT – Asmara, Eritrea
Eritrean Institute of Technology (EIT) main campus is located about 20Kms from the Capital of Eritrea Asmara in Mai-Nefhi. Indeed, another name for the institution is Mai-Nefhi College. Who is using Koha
More than 1000 libraries are using Koha, including academic, public, school and special libraries, in Africa, Australia, Canada, USA, France, India and, of course, New Zealand.
